Obi-Strips

日本から輸入したアルバムをレコード店で見つけたことを覚えていますか?
(Translation) Remember spotting imported albums from Japan in record stores?

Our cassette obi-strips emulate the style of a Japanese release! Printed obi-strips traditionally had an album description or a price for consumer interest, but you can use this slip of canvas however you like! They can even be designed horizontally, also known as “belly-bands”.

Slipcases

Special editions are a great way to commemorate album releases, whether it’s an anniversary reissue or a deluxe version with b-sides, instrumentals, live recordings, and more. Like home video releases, a tried and true package for special releases is the printed slipcase.

We have two versions: the Norelco O-Card, which has openings on the top and bottom of the cassette. The other is the Norelco Slipcase, which has an opening on the right side, allowing the cassette to be easily removed with the help of the thumbhole on the top and bottom.

Uncoated J-Cards

Beneath the hood of slipcases and cassette boxes lies the J-card, an unfurling scroll of artwork and liner notes for you to design to your heart’s content. Our standard J-cards are printed on our bright and vivid Cougar™ Super Smooth cardstock, with the option to choose uncoated printing. Uncoated means your paper won’t appear or feel glossy, but instead have a rougher matte texture. The tangible feeling of the paper gives the J-card an unquestionably artistic texture, as if printed with painting material as opposed to ink. Must be seen, and felt, to be believed!
